Tariq Ramadan (PhD, Geneva) is one of the foremost international voices for the understanding of Muslims in the West and Islamic revival in the Muslim world. Educated at the University of Geneva and al-Azhar University, Tariq Ramadan is Professor of Contemporary Islamic Studies at Qatar University. Professor Ramadan has written over twenty books, including The Quest for Meaning: Developing a Philosophy of Pluralism, What I Believe, and Radical Reform: Islamic Ethics and Liberation.
